Common Causes and Symptoms of Tooth Pain

Tooth pain, or toothache, can manifest in various ways, from a dull ache to sharp, throbbing sensations. Understanding the potential causes can help you better communicate with your dentist. Common culprits include:

  • Dental caries (cavities) that have progressed to the tooth’s inner layers.
  • Gum disease, which can lead to receding gums and exposed tooth roots.
  • Cracked or chipped teeth, often resulting from injury or biting down on hard objects.
  • Abscesses, which are infections at the root of the tooth or in the gums.
  • Sinus infections, which can sometimes cause referred pain to the upper teeth.
  • Bruxism (teeth grinding), which can lead to sensitivity and pain.

Your pain might be exacerbated by hot or cold temperatures, pressure when biting, or even spontaneous throbbing. Recognizing these signs is the first step toward seeking appropriate dental care.

When to Seek Immediate Dental Care

While some tooth pain may be manageable with over-the-counter pain relievers, certain symptoms warrant immediate attention from a dentist. These include:

  • Severe, unbearable pain that interferes with daily activities.
  • Swelling in the face, jaw, or gums.
  • Fever accompanying the tooth pain.
  • Difficulty breathing or swallowing.
  • A foul taste in your mouth, indicating a possible infection.

Ignoring these signs can lead to more serious complications, so it’s crucial to consult a dental professional without delay.

The Dental Consultation Process for Suffering Teeth

Upon arriving at a dental clinic in or around Casas Adobes, your dentist will typically begin with a thorough examination. This often involves:

  • **Medical History Review:** Discussing your symptoms, overall health, and any medications you’re taking.
  • **Visual Inspection:** Examining your teeth and gums for visible signs of decay, infection, or injury.
  • **Dental X-rays:** Utilized to identify issues not visible to the naked eye, such as impacted wisdom teeth, bone loss, or cavities between teeth.
  • **Sensitivity Tests:** Applying cold or air stimuli to pinpoint the affected tooth and assess its nerve response.

Once a diagnosis is made, your dentist will discuss the most suitable treatment options for your specific condition.

Common Tooth Pain Treatment Methods

The treatment for tooth pain is highly dependent on its underlying cause. However, several common methods are employed by dentists in the Casas Adobes area:

  • **Fillings:** For cavities, dentists remove decayed tooth structure and fill the space with materials like composite resin or amalgam.
  • **Root Canals:** If the tooth’s pulp (the inner nerve and blood vessel tissue) becomes infected or inflamed, a root canal procedure cleans out the infected material, disinfects the canals, and seals them to save the tooth.
  • **Extractions:** In cases where a tooth is severely damaged or infected beyond repair, extraction may be necessary. This is often a last resort to alleviate persistent pain.
  • **Antibiotics:** For dental abscesses or infections, dentists may prescribe antibiotics to combat the bacteria.
  • **Gum Disease Treatment:** Procedures like scaling and root planing are used to treat periodontal disease, which can cause significant tooth sensitivity and pain.
  • **Crowns and Bridges:** If a tooth is weakened by decay or damage, a crown can be placed to protect it. Bridges can replace missing teeth, preventing adjacent teeth from shifting and causing further pain.

What are the most common reasons for sudden tooth pain?

Sudden tooth pain can stem from several issues, including acute dental caries (cavities) that have reached the nerve, a cracked or chipped tooth, a dental abscess (infection), or even inflammation of the pulp, often due to trauma or deep decay. Sometimes, problems like impacted wisdom teeth can also cause sudden and intense discomfort.

What can I do to manage tooth pain at home before seeing a dentist?

While waiting for your dental appointment, you can manage pain by rinsing your mouth with warm salt water (which can help reduce inflammation and clean the area), taking over-the-counter pain relievers like ibuprofen or acetaminophen as directed, and avoiding very hot, cold, or sugary foods and drinks. You can also try a cold compress on the outside of your cheek to reduce swelling. However, these are temporary measures, and it’s essential to see a dentist promptly for diagnosis and treatment.
